Pride and Prejudice, a comedy of manners and marriage, is the most famous of Jane Austen's novels. In this dramatic adaption by Mary Keith Medbery Macakaye some liberties are taken with the storyline and characters, but it is still a fun listen or read. Perhaps a good introduction for someone not ready to tackle the complete novel ~ and for the reader familiar with the work, a laugh can be had at the changes that were made in order to adapt it to the stage (Summary by Maria Therese) Cast: Mr. Darcy: Algy Pug Mr. Bingley: Chris Marcellus Colonel Fitzwilliam/Harris/Martin: ToddHW Mr. Bennet: Robert Hoffman and Kevin W.
